    My Macbook Pro started acting weird with screen flickering and freezing. Looking up online and…read moreperforming a basic triage suggested that it was an video card problem. I called Apple Support and they told me that I could bring the laptop to Connecting Point as it's an authorized repair shop and it would be covered by my warranty. I brought the laptop to Connecting Point, explaining the symtom with a video I recorded showing the screen flickering. The guy also believed that it's likely a video card issue and the replacement would be covered by warranty. However, the next day I received a call to pickup my laptop. This time it was another person and he said the problem was due to hard drive corruption. Based on my initial triaged, I was quite certain that it wasn't the hard drive fault. But the guy insisted and I gave the benefit of the doubt. I was $60 for hard drive failure because the drive I had was third-party and won't be covered by AppleCare. That's fair if the problem was due to hard drive. After I came back, I googled for a way to run hardware diagnosis and found that every Mac includes Apple Hardware Test with the installation CD. I ran it and within minutes it showed that the video card is faulty. I brought the machine back and let them know that the problem wasn't the harddrive but the video card. At first, without letting me explain, argued that if they said it was hard drive then it's definitely the hard drive, until I mentioned the code they were ok to try to run the diagnostic software and found the exact same error code. Although it is obvious that the problem was due to the video card and it will be covered by AppleCare. They didn't refund me $60 I paid for their "mis-diagnostic", but rather came up with irrelevant/rude arguments with me. There was a problem and they did not find it for whatever reason, and they thinks it's reasonable to charge me for that. So do yourself a favor, if you have an issue with your Mac, just send it to Apple directly. Although it might takes 2 days more for the shipping, you will be dealing with a lot more respectful and professional persons, who won't try to rip you off.
